Root canal treatment involves removing the tissues from the tooth’s interior. The interiors and root canals are thoroughly cleaned, and a restorative material known as gutta-percha is then applied to the interior. Often, the tooth is then capped with a dental crown. The restoration is often custom-made to protect the tooth and also look natural. But if there are complications with the procedure, the prognosis of the condition could be compromised. The tooth could begin developing symptoms, such as toothaches and discomfort when biting down. If you experience this type of discomfort, do not risk the loss of your teeth.
